Transaction 2fc7fb911e85ed995ecb15949fe2142055f2a486e454726d3bfe9a36a9dd9c6c

1 Input
2 Outputs
  • 2fc7fb911e85ed995ecb15949fe2142055f2a486e454726d3bfe9a36a9dd9c6c:0
  • value  32415313620
    address  1EGBAoVQfLeZUsVXdigLrk7YbF37RGzk61
  • 2fc7fb911e85ed995ecb15949fe2142055f2a486e454726d3bfe9a36a9dd9c6c:1
  • value  150681643
    address  1NkrjPpQu9RY2bLiFwAyr5cFgy9xmHb8d